Fiancé Visas are used by immigrants who want to visit the U.S. and marry an U.S. citizen of St. Clair Shores MI.
In order to qualify for this visa, the couple must provide evidence of an engagement or a contract to marry, and the two people must have met at least once within the prior two years.
Filing a Petition for Your Fiancé' in St. Clair Shores Michigan
Fiancé petitions cannot be filed outside of the United States. Although you plan on living in St. Clair Shores all of your immigration paperwork must be filed with the correct regional USCIS office. You can find the location of these regional offices by looking at your current immigration forms or consulting with an immigration attorney.
After you have submitted the petition, the process will begin. Because the person seeking to enter the U.S. is still an immigrant, he or she must still meet the requirements for a regular visa.
Modifying Your Fiancé Visa Application After Marriage
Once the petition has been authorized and the K-1 visa granted, a wedding must occur within 90 days. A K-1 fiancé may only enter the U.S. one time. After the wedding has occurred, the visa holder may apply for an adjustment of status as a lawful permanent resident.
